  • A 75-hour Taiwan mandarin corpus for recognition has been released. The speech samples are collected in Taiwan. In total of 100 native Taiwan speakers (1:1 gender distribution) from the major areas of Taiwan are carefully selected. The corpus has effective duration of 75 hours. It is recorded using 16 kHz sampling frequency and 16-bit quantization accuracy in mono PCM format. The corpus is collected using various Android smart models and primarily in indoor environment.
  • A 1000 people gait recognition database has been released. It covered 1000 people (1:1 gender distribution) with the age from 4 to 85 where 20% of the participants are above 60-year-old. Gait recognition database was collected by 24 Hikvision cameras in outdoor environment. 1000 participants with their normal walking posture was recorded by these cameras. Each participant is asked to walk 48 times with 3 sets of outfits (one is normal, one with a coat and the other one with a bag). The resolution ratio is 1920*1080@25fps and the format is MP4.

  • A 50-hour Children Bilingual Corpus for Recognition has been released. It covered 140 children with the age from 5 to 12 with 1:1 gender distribution. The corpus contains 25-hour mandarin and 25-hour English (including word’s pronunciation and alphablocks ), which covered the texts and words in elementary school textbooks. It is recorded in real environments using 16 kHz sampling frequency and 16-bit quantization accuracy mono PCM format. The corpus is collected using various Android smart phone models and primarily in indoor (quiet and anechoic ) environments.   • A 400-hour On-Vehicle Japanese Corpus for Recognition has been released. The speech samples are collected in Japan and China. In total of 1000 native Japanese speakers from the major areas of Japan are carefully selected.The corpus is collected inside various cars. The recording environments have covered practical scenarios including and not limited to the variations in high/low vehicle speed and parking, window open and close modes.   • A 2000-hour Multi-dialectal Corpus for Recognition has been released. The corpus contains two Chinese dialects - Northeastern dialect and Henan dialect. The speech samples are all collected from the corresponding provinces while ensuring subtle varieties amongst neighboring cities and provinces. For example, the Northeast dialect corpus is collected from the cities in all of the three northeast provinces (i.e. Heilongjiang Province, Jilin Province, and Liaoning Province).
